Debian Adding "Hard Dependency" on Rust, May Abandon Some PC Architectures 03.11.2025 15:42
APT, Debian’s package manager also used by Ubuntu, to have a hard Rust requirement. Debian may “sunset” ports (such as PowerPC & m68k) which are not fully supported by Rust.
